Possible Novel Extraction for 1,2-EDB

I've been thinking about the GC-ECD methods 8011 and 504 that use hexane to extract 35mL of water in a voa with 2mL of hexane. Then 2uL is injected for analysis.

SW846 Method 3585 uses hexadecane to dilute oily material and then an aliquot is purged for 8260 VOC analysis. This works because hexadecane does not purge onto the trap.
What if we took a 40mL vial and removed 5mL then added 2-5mL of hexadecane and put it on a rotator followed by sonication and then take an aliquot of that to purge for 8260 SIM analysis. Potentially with 2mL hexadecane and and 35mL of sample purging 1mL of extract could get a one could get an ~8X concentration factor relative to purging 5mL of water.
I suppose it would depend on whether 1,2-DCA and 1,2-EDB would have a good partitioning into the hexadecane.

Comments?
I tried this out and putting the entire 2mL of hexadecane in the autosampler vial does not work. I'm going to try again with a smaller aliquot.
